“Early ’90s TV is hitting the refresh button this fall, in the case of “The Wonder Years,” delivering an impressive and ambitious ABC dramedy.

“Coming on the heels of Disney+’s “Doogie Howser, M.D.” reboot, the two shows join the earlier “One Day at a Time” in proving it’s possible to nostalgically recycle titles and still produce distinctive and captivating series.

“Directed by original star Fred Savage, “The Wonder Years” revisits roughly the same period beginning in 1968, this time examining those turbulent years from the perspective of an African-American family and its 12-year-old son, Dean (Elisha “EJ” Williams).”
